Wellington Hockey Association Umpire Feedback Form
To assist the growth and development of our umpiring community we are appealing to clubs and administrators to provide feedback on our umpires performances during games.

Much like players, our umpires learn through practice and experience and can benefit from the constructive feedback from our community. With positive and meaningful feedback from our community we can pinpoint areas of development for our umpires to focus on and offer the Wellington region a higher level of umpiring.
